Why do you believe the star local student should be recognized?

She wrote a children’s book on helping children with social anxiety. She read it to groups of children at an elementary school, libraries and Girl Scout Troops. She collaborated with individuals to have the books translated into Spanish and German to reach a wider audience. All proceeds from her book “Chasing Butterflies” found on Amazon, go to purchasing books for non-profits. libraries and family shelters.
